Navigating Tough Discussions About Self-Perception and Societal Pressures

Connections, if romantic, kin-related, or platonic, are based on communication. But what occurs when the talks become difficult, when conflicts develop, or when delicate subjects require attention? The ability to handle these difficult talks is crucial for preserving sound and lasting bonds. This article investigates the technique of difficult conversations, with a focus on the intricate issue of body image and social expectations, presenting helpful strategies for handling these delicate topics productively and enhancing relationships with others.

Understanding the Origins of Disagreement Regarding Self-Perception:

Discord surrounding body image frequently originates from a deep-rooted cultural demand to fit into flawed standards of attractiveness. These ideals, often perpetuated by media, marketing, and networking sites, can contribute to:

Internalized Misogyny: Persons, especially girls, may ingrain these standards, resulting in self-doubt, unhappiness with their appearance, and even disordered eating patterns.
Social Comparison: Perpetual contact with perfected images can foster a climate of comparison, leading to emotions of incompetence and diminished self-regard.
Objectification and Sexualization: The stress on physical attributes, particularly in the instance of breasts, can result in the dehumanization and sexualization of girls, devaluing them to their bodily features.
These cultural influences can create strain within relationships, causing:

Communication Problems: Difficulty in expressing concerns about self-perception or social expectations without feeling condemned or dismissed.
Relationship Strain: Ill will and conflict can occur when significant others possess disparate opinions on physical appearance or have varying encounters with societal pressures.
Emotional Distress: Individuals may encounter unease, dejection, or other psychological challenges due to the continuous stress to conform to flawed ideals of beauty.
Preparing for Difficult Conversations About here Self-Perception:

Before initiating a discussion about physical appearance, it's essential to:

Generate a Safe and Supportive Environment: Pick a point and location where you and your significant other experience comfortable and protected to convey your ideas and feelings without apprehension of criticism or criticism.
Think about Your Own Physical Appearance: Understand your own connection with your physical form and how cultural influences have affected you.
Center on Understanding and Empathy: Approach the discussion with sensitivity and a genuine desire to understand your partner's perspective.
Define Clear Boundaries: Establish clear boundaries for the discussion, making sure that both individuals feel respected and heard.

Efficient Communication Techniques:

Active Listening: Listen carefully to what your companion is saying, both verbally and through body language. Recognize their feelings and confirm their situations, even if you don't hold the same perspective.
""I" Assertions: Express your own emotions and encounters using "I" statements, like "I get worried when I notice..." or "I worry that..." This helps to avoid accusing or accusing your companion.
Question Societal Standards Together: Have candid and truthful dialogues about the flawed ideals of beauty reinforced by media and the world. Question these standards jointly and investigate alternative points of view.
Concentrate on Wellness: Change the attention from physical attributes to total well-being. Encourage healthy habits, for example exercise, nutrition, and personal care, that encourage both bodily and emotional wellness.
Seek Support: In the event that you or your partner are struggling with body image issues, contemplate looking for help from a counselor who specializes in issues related to self-perception.
Managing Challenging Discussions About Physical Appearance: A Path to Growth and Understanding

Managing challenging discussions about body image necessitates patience, empathy, and a devotion to frank and sincere dialogue. By using efficient communication methods, challenging social standards together, and concentrating on wellness, partners can handle these delicate topics with increased comprehension and reinforce their connection. Bear in mind, the objective is not to modify your partner's point of view, but to establish a safe and supportive atmosphere where you can both examine your own situations with physical appearance and cultural influences.
